Activity itinerary

Puente de los Tirantes
  • 15m
Our route runs parallel to the Lérez riverbed, a river that we make the protagonist of our entire tour. Following the walk, we will make a first stop in the vicinity of the Santiago Bridge with views towards the Puente de los Tirantes, one of the main civil engineering works of the late 20th century. In addition, we will highlight the natural importance of the Island of Sculptures and the unique Pasarela de los Cobos.
Puente de las Corrientes
  • 25m
On the way to the Puente das Correntes we will make a stop at one of the viewpoints on the Uruguay Avenue promenade to enjoy the lights of the bridges. Next, the tour stops at the outer platforms of the Puente das Correntes to learn about its history, the importance of its location, and the views of the A Barca Bridge.
Puente del Burgo
  • 30m
The tour continues along the Paseo Domingo Fontán at whose main viewpoint we will explain the importance of the Marismas da Xunqueira de Alba and the diversity of its fauna and flora. In the vicinity of the Puente del Burgo we will take the opportunity to learn about its architecture and all the curiosities of the key infrastructure of the origin of the city of Pontevedra.
Puente del Burgo
  • 15m
We walked along the pedestrian platform of the monument. A work whose recent rehabilitation allows us to explain the process of humanization that since 1999 has transformed the urban reality of the city. In addition, it is a magical place that connects us with the Lérez River, with its banks, the Pilgrimage Route to Compostela and with the stars of the Milky Way. A point of magic in which we will tell some legends.
Muralla de Pontevedra
  • 20m
The last part of the tour takes place in the Plaza de Valentín García Escudero. Nothing less than one of the most unique open-air museums in the city, because, among other elements, we will see remains of the medieval walls of the 12th, 15th and 16th centuries, in addition to the original arches of the medieval bridge as well as the remains of the boardwalks or one of the milestones from Roman times found. Everything to discover and much to know about the incredible history of Pontevedra!
